Jasmine Pineda and Gino Palazzolo reached a breaking point on 90 Day Fiancé: Happily Ever After. Gino accused Jasmine of using him for immigration benefits. He demanded she repay him tens of thousands of dollars.
90 Day Fiancé: Gino Reads His Explosive Letter
The tense scene began with Gino reading a letter he had written to Jasmine. “Jasmine, I really thought you loved me when we spoke for three years while you were in Panama,” he said. “However, once you arrived in Michigan, you treated me horribly daily… It is obvious that you used me to come to the US and obtain a green card. This was the biggest mistake of my life.”
He went on to put a price tag on the relationship. “You owe me $40,000 for all the money I transferred to Panama. You owe me $10,000 for the wedding. $1,225 for a green card. $10,000 for the K-1 and the green card. I need $5,000 for a divorce lawyer. So all this money adds up to a good $70,000.”
At one point, his anger boiled over as he told Jasmine: “There’s a scam as marriage fraud to the T.”
Jasmine Pushes Back
Jasmine looked stunned but defended herself. “What is immigration going to do? I didn’t do anything criminal,” she said. “I married you and the marriage didn’t work.”
